编译原理第二次作业

文章讲述了如何在不配置环境的情况下修改homework2文件,强调了flexbison的安装路径选择、gcc的可选使用以及devc++路径的要求。作者分享了手动调整和运行脚本的过程,最后表达了对课程内容的新看法。
摘要由CSDN通过智能技术生成

1.不想配置环境,直接改我的

homework2.zip

解压后,修改homework2.y 文件里的我的名字和学号
一定要改啊
一定要改啊
!!!!

编译原理第二次作业-0

2. 配置环境

1.下载配置flex bison
Compressed.zip
解压后安装
!!!在安装这里有个大坑,不要用默认的路径,软件默认的路径有空格,一定要自己改成一个没有中文和空格的路径,我被这个玩意快玩死了
配置环境变量参考下面的
windows中flex词法分析器的安装、配置和使用_我在改变世界的博客-CSDN博客_windows下flex安装

3. gcc 可以不安装

因为devc++可以直接运行,
注意这里还是注意一点
devc++的安装路径不能有空格和中文
devc++默认的安装路径带空格,我无语了一下午。

4. 运行脚本

bison homework2.y
flex homework2.l
gcc lex.yy.c

5. 成功截图

编译原理第二次作业-1

最后的感言

感谢徐老师的辛苦出题,我在网上没找到一个可以完美运行的程序。
自己手动还是改了点,好麻烦。

选择离开后反而对课程内容没有了太多的挑剔
愿意去看啦。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值